I absolutely fell in love with the new Gnome One Like You set, so, of course, I had to use that for toda'ys card, along with the Slimline Hearts background die



For the background here, I started with a sheet of white Neenah cardstock. I blended on distress oxide in Dried Marigold for the whole pane, darker on top and lightest near the bottom. I then added Abandon Coral to the top 2/3rds of the panel in the same way, dark to light and blending into the Marigold. Lastly, I added Wilted Violet to the top 1/3 blending it into the Coral. I love this combo as it feels like a sunset to me! I then die cut the panel with the Slimline Hearts Die. Before popping it out, I added glue to all the hearts and affixed it to a plain white panel so I wouldn't waste anything. Two cards for one! I gently peeled up the border once the hearts dried. I stamped the sentiments in the same ink colors. I tried to blend the coral and the violet for a two-tone look. 


For the gnomes I did a little Copic coloring. I had actually started these first and the purple parts were actually a light pink. But once the background was done, I wanted to change it to pink. Since Copics are transparent, it is easy to lay another color on top of light colors, and I was able to put the purple over the pink! 


Copic Colors: E53, E51, E00, YR04, YR02, YR00, N4, N0, W2, BV01, BV0000
